html, body {
  margin: 0 0 0 0;
  padding: 0 0 0 0;
  font: normal 12px "arial", "helvetica", sans-serif;
  background-color: #403E82;
	text-align: center;
	margin: 0px auto;
  padding: 0px;
}

.Table_403E82 {
	border-top-color: #403E82;
	border-top-width: 1px;
	border-top-style: solid;

	border-right-color: #403E82;
	border-right-width: 1px;
	border-right-style: solid;

	border-left-color: #403E82;
	border-left-width: 1px;
	border-left-style: solid;

	border-bottom-color: #403E82;
	border-bottom-style: solid;
	border-bottom-width: 1px;
}

.Table_FFFFFF {
	border-top-color: #FFFFFF;
	border-top-width: 1px;
	border-top-style: solid;

	border-right-color: #FFFFFF;
	border-right-width: 1px;
	border-right-style: solid;

	border-left-color: #FFFFFF;
	border-left-width: 1px;
	border-left-style: solid;

	border-bottom-color: #FFFFFF;
	border-bottom-style: solid;
	border-bottom-width: 1px;
}

#TblContent {
	border-top-color: #403E82;
	border-top-width: 1px;
	border-top-style: solid;

	border-right-color: #403E82;
	border-right-width: 1px;
	border-right-style: solid;

	border-left-color: #403E82;
	border-left-width: 1px;
	border-left-style: solid;

	border-bottom-color: #403E82;
	border-bottom-style: solid;
	border-bottom-width: 1px;
}

#TblLft {
  background-color: #FFFFFF;
  background: url("/navimg/menu_boczne.gif");
  background-repeat: no-repeat;

	border-top-color: #403E82;
	border-top-width: 1px;
	border-top-style: solid;

	border-right-color: #403E82;
	border-right-width: 1px;
	border-right-style: solid;

	border-left-color: #403E82;
	border-left-width: 1px;
	border-left-style: solid;

	border-bottom-color: #403E82;
	border-bottom-style: solid;
	border-bottom-width: 1px;
}

#TblRght {
  background-color: #FFFFFF;
  background: url("/navimg/menu_boczne.gif");
  background-repeat: no-repeat;

	border-top-color: #403E82;
	border-top-width: 1px;
	border-top-style: solid;

	border-right-color: #403E82;
	border-right-width: 1px;
	border-right-style: solid;

	border-left-color: #403E82;
	border-left-width: 1px;
	border-left-style: solid;

	border-bottom-color: #403E82;
	border-bottom-style: solid;
	border-bottom-width: 1px;
}

p.h_stomia {color: #0000ff;  font-family: arial, helvetica, sans-serif; font-size: 12pt; font-style: normal; line-height: normal; text-decoration: none; font-weight: bolder;}

h1 { text-align: center }
h1.robots_h1_ff0000 {color: #ff0000; font: bolder 16px "arial", "helvetica", sans-serif; text-decoration: none; text-align: left; }
h1.robots_h1_bb0000 {color: #bb0000; font: bolder 18px "arial", "helvetica", sans-serif; text-decoration: none; text-align: left; }

p.align { text-align: justify; text-indent: 30px }
p.ident { text-indent: 30px}
p.link {color: #000000;
	font: normal 10pt "arial", "helvetica", sans-serif;
	text-decoration: underline;
}

ul.sklepy {
  color: #000000;
  line-height: 30px;
  font: normal 15px "arial", "helvetica", sans-serif;
}

.Level_1         { color: #403E82; font: bolder 11pt "arial", "helvetica", sans-serif; text-decoration: none; }

.Level_2_none    { color: #403E82; font: bolder 8pt "arial", "helvetica", sans-serif; text-decoration: none; }
.Level_2         { color: #403E82; font: bolder 8pt "arial", "helvetica", sans-serif; text-decoration: underline; }
.Level_2:active  { ; }
.Level_2:visited { ; }
.Level_2:hover   { color: #008800; text-decoration: none; }

.Level_3         { color: #403E82; font: normal 8pt "arial", "helvetica", sans-serif; text-decoration: underline; }
.Level_3:active  { ; }
.Level_3:visited { ; }
.Level_3:hover   { color: #008800; text-decoration: none; }

a.begin_none {
  color: #000000;
  font: normal 12px "times new roman", times, sans-serif;
  text-decoration: none;
}

a.begin {
  color: #000000;
  font: normal 12px "times new roman", times, sans-serif;
  text-decoration: none;
}
a.begin:link { text-decoration: none; }
a.begin:active { text-decoration: none; }
a.begin:visited { text-decoration: none; }
a.begin:hover { text-decoration: underline; }

a.details {
  color: #ff0000;
  text-decoration: none;
}
a.details:link { text-decoration: none; }
a.details:active { text-decoration: none; }
a.details:visited { text-decoration: none; }
a.details:hover { text-decoration: underline; }

.wozki_lnk {
  color: #0000CC;
  font: normal 12px "arial", "helvetica", sans-serif;
  text-decoration: none;
 }
.wozki_lnk:link { text-decoration: none; }
.wozki_lnk:active { text-decoration: none; }
.wozki_lnk:visited { text-decoration: none; }
.wozki_lnk:hover { text-decoration: underline; }


.robots_h1 {color: #FF0000; font: bolder 11pt "Arial", "Helvetica", sans-serif; text-decoration: none; text-align: left; }

.header_01 {
  color: #0000ff;
	font: bolder 22px "arial", "helvetica", sans-serif;
	text-decoration: none;
}
.header_01:link { text-decoration: none; }
.header_01:active { text-decoration: none; }
.header_01:visited { text-decoration: none; }
.header_01:hover { text-decoration: underline; }
.header_01_none {
  color: #0000ff;
	font: bolder 22px "arial", "helvetica", sans-serif;
	text-decoration: none;
}

.header_01_none_center_middle {
  color: #0000ff;
	font: bolder 22px "arial", "helvetica", sans-serif;
	text-decoration: none;
  text-align: center;
  vertical-align: middle;
}

.header_02 {
  color: #000080;
  font: normal 20px "arial", "helvetica", sans-serif;
}
.header_02:link { text-decoration: none; }
.header_02:active { text-decoration: none; }
.header_02:visited { text-decoration: none; }
.header_02:hover { text-decoration: underline; }
.header_02_none {
  color: #000080;
  font: normal 20px "arial", "helvetica", sans-serif;
  text-decoration: none;
}
.header_02_none_center {
  color: #000080;
  font: normal 20px "arial", "helvetica", sans-serif;
  text-decoration: none;
}
.header_02_none_center_middle {
  color: #000080;
  font: normal 20px "arial", "helvetica", sans-serif;
  text-decoration: none;
  text-align: center;
  vertical-align: middle;
}


.header_02_blue {
  color: #000080;
  font: bold 16px "arial", "helvetica", sans-serif;
  text-align: left;
}
.header_02_blue:link { text-decoration: none; }
.header_02_blue:active { text-decoration: none; }
.header_02_blue:visited { text-decoration: none; }
.header_02_blue:hover { text-decoration: underline; }
.header_02_blue_none {
  color: #000080;
  font: bold 16px "arial", "helvetica", sans-serif;
  text-decoration: none;
  text-align: left;
}
.header_03 {
  color: #000000;
  font: bold 16px "arial", "helvetica", sans-serif;
  text-align: left;
}
.header_03:link { text-decoration: none; }
.header_03:active { text-decoration: none; }
.header_03:visited { text-decoration: none; }
.header_03:hover { text-decoration: underline; }
.header_03_none {
  color: #000000;
  font: bold 16px "arial", "helvetica", sans-serif;
  text-decoration: none;
  text-align: left;
}

.header_04 {
  color: #bb0000;
  font: normal 14px "arial", "helvetica", sans-serif;
  text-decoration: none;
  text-align: left;
}
.header_04:link { text-decoration: none; }
.header_04:active { text-decoration: none; }
.header_04:visited { text-decoration: none; }
.header_04:hover { text-decoration: underline; }
.header_04_none {
  color: #bb0000;
  font: normal 14px "arial", "helvetica", sans-serif;
  text-decoration: none;
  text-align: left;
}

.header_04_producenci {
  color: #000080;
  font: normal 14px "arial", "helvetica", sans-serif;
  text-decoration: none;
}

div.list_text {
  color: #000000;
  font: normal 12px "arial", "helvetica", sans-serif;
  text-decoration: none;
}

li.list_text {
  color: #000000;
  font: normal 12px "arial", "helvetica", sans-serif;
  text-decoration: none;
}

td {
  vertical-align: top;
  text-align: left;
}

td.right { text-align: right; }
td.center { text-align: center;}


td.left_top {
  text-align: left;
  vertical-align: top;
}

td.center_middle {
  text-align: center;
  vertical-align: middle;
}

td.center_top {
  text-align: center;
  vertical-align: top;
}

td.center_bottom {
  text-align: center;
  vertical-align: bottom;
}

td.left {
  text-align: left;
}

td.left_middle {
  text-align: left;
  vertical-align: middle;
}

td.left_bottom {
  text-align: left;
  vertical-align: bottom;
}

td.right_middle {
  text-align: right;
  vertical-align: middle;
}

td.tech {
  font-size: 10px;
  text-align: center;
}

td.tech_b {
  font-size: 10px;
  text-align: left;
  font: bolder;
}

td.tech_left {
  font-size: 10px;
  text-align: left;
}

td.colors {
  font: bolder 10px "arial", "helvetica";
  text-align: center;
}

td.aktualnosci {
   background-color: #77ccff;
}

td.sklepy_reprezentaci {
   background-color: #e0e0e0;
   text-align: left;
   vertical-align: middle;
}

.justuj {
	text-align: justify ;
	text-indent: 20px;
}


#BODY {
	width: 1000px;
	margin: 0 auto;
	clear: both;
  position: relative;
  left: 0px;
  top: 0px;
	text-align: left;
  padding: 0px;
  padding-bottom: 5px;
	min-height: 480px;
	background-color: #FFFFFF;
}

#prawa {
	width: 785px;
	margin: 0 auto;
	float: left;
  position: relative;
  left: 0px;
  top: 0px;
	text-align: left;
  padding: 0px;
  padding-bottom: 5px;
	min-height: 480px;
	background-color: #FFFFFF;
}


#STOPKA-1 {
	width: 1000px;
	margin: 0 auto;
  padding-top: 2px;
  padding-bottom: 2px;
	background-color: #0099DD;
}


#STOPKA-2 {
	width: 1000px;
	margin: 0 auto;
  padding-top: 2px;
	min-height: 50px;
	background-color: #403e82;
}


ul.menu2 {padding: 0px; margin: 0px;}
li.menu2-level-0  { color: #000088; list-style: none; padding-left: 10px; margin-top: 0px; margin-bottom: 0px; }
li.menu2-level-1  { color: #000088; list-style: none; padding-left: 10px; margin-top: 0px; padding-top: 3px; margin-bottom: 0px; font: normal 8pt "arial", "helvetica", sans-serif; text-decoration: none;}
li.menu2-level-1_s  { color: #FF0000; text-decoration: none; list-style: none; padding-left: 10px; margin-top: 0px; padding-top: 3px; margin-bottom: 0px; font: normal 8pt "arial", "helvetica", sans-serif; text-decoration: none;}
li.menu2-level-1:visited { ;}
li.menu2-level-2  { list-style: none; padding-left: 10px; margin-top: 0px; margin-bottom: 0px; }
li.menu2-level-2:visited { ;}
li.menu2-level-3  { list-style: none; padding-left: 10px; margin-top: 0px; margin-bottom: 0px; }

a {text-decoration: none; }

a.menu2:visited   { color: #000088;}
a.menu2:link      { color: #000088;}
a.menu2:active    { color: #000088;}
a.menu2:hover     { color: #FF0000; text-decoration: underline; }

a.menu2_s         { color: #FF0000; text-decoration: none; }
a.menu2_s:active  { color: #FF0000; }
a.menu2_s:visited { color: #FF0000; }
a.menu2_s:hover   { color: #FF0000; text-decoration: underline; }

a.nav         { color: #000088; text-decoration: none; font: normal 10px "arial", "helvetica", sans-serif; padding-left: 2px; padding-right: 2px;}
a.nav:active  { color: #000088; }
a.nav:visited { color: #000088; }
a.nav:hover   { color: #000088; text-decoration: underline; }